Before You File

Documentation is everything. Capture clear photos and videos of the damage, make a list of affected items, and review your insurance policy. Beware of scams—avoid signing agreements with "storm chasers" or unverified contractors. Always check credentials, insurance, and references before hiring. Unsure where to start?
